India's Most Energy Efficient Transport: Understanding Tonne-km

Transport efficiency is measured by how much energy is used to move goods. A key metric for this is energy consumption per tonne-kilometre (tonne-km). This tells us the energy needed to transport one tonne of cargo over a distance of one kilometre. A lower value indicates higher efficiency.

The question asks to identify which transport system in India is the most efficient in terms of this energy usage.

Comparing Energy Efficiency Across Transport Modes

Different transportation methods have different energy footprints. Here's a general comparison:

  • Inland Waterways: Moving goods via rivers, canals, and other inland water bodies is widely recognised as the most energy-efficient method. Vessels like barges can carry very large quantities of cargo with relatively low fuel consumption. The low friction between the hull and water contributes significantly to this efficiency.

  • Railways: Trains are the second most efficient mode for freight transport. They are designed to carry heavy loads and long distances with less energy expenditure compared to road transport. Steel wheels on steel rails offer less rolling resistance.

  • Roadways: Road transport, primarily using trucks, is generally less energy-efficient than both waterways and railways. Factors such as tyre-road friction, air resistance, engine efficiency, and the often stop-and-go nature of road travel increase energy consumption per tonne-km.

  • Airways: Air freight is the least energy-efficient mode. The high speeds required and the significant energy needed for lift-off and flight result in substantially higher energy consumption compared to other modes.

In India, promoting inland waterways is seen as a strategy to reduce logistics costs and carbon emissions due to their inherent energy efficiency.

Therefore, based on the principle of energy consumption per tonne-km, inland waterways are the most efficient transport system among the options provided.
